One of the standout features of Ingenia servo drives is their advanced networking capabilities. These drives support a wide range of communication protocols, including EtherCAT, CANopen, and Modbus, making it easy to integrate them into existing control systems. This allows for seamless communication between the servo drives and other devices, ensuring reliable operation and real-time data exchange.
